What Caregiver Techniques Actually Work for Memory Loss?

Effective memory care doesn't try to correct or argue with someone experiencing confusion—it meets them where they are. Caregivers use simple language, break tasks into single steps, and offer visual cues instead of lengthy explanations. If someone forgets they've eaten lunch, a caregiver might redirect to a pleasant activity rather than debating the meal that just happened.

Structured activities tailored to individual interests keep minds engaged without causing frustration. Someone who enjoyed gardening might sort seed packets or arrange flowers. Music from earlier decades often sparks recognition and calm. These aren't generic entertainment—they're chosen based on life history and current capabilities, then adjusted as conditions change. Safety measures are woven into daily life subtly: doors secured without appearing locked, medications managed discreetly, supervision that doesn't feel intrusive.
